#### Benefits and Uses of Vertical FRP Tanks in Industrial Applications.

Vertical Fiber Reinforced Plastic (FRP) tanks have gained increasing popularity in various industrial applications due to their unique advantages over traditional materials. This article explores the key benefits and uses of vertical FRP tanks, shedding light on why industries are opting for this innovative solution.

**1. Corrosion Resistance**.

One of the standout benefits of vertical FRP tanks is their exceptional corrosion resistance. Unlike traditional materials like metal, which can corrode when exposed to harsh chemicals or environmental conditions, FRP tanks are designed to withstand corrosive substances. This resistance significantly extends the lifespan of the tank, reducing maintenance costs and downtime associated with repairs or replacements.

**2. Lightweight and Ease of Installation**.

FRP tanks are considerably lighter than their metal counterparts. This lightweight nature allows for easier transportation and installation, especially in areas with limited accessibility. Industrial facilities can save on transportation costs and labor, making FRP tanks a cost-effective solution for large-scale operations. Additionally, the ease of installation reduces project timelines, allowing businesses to ramp up their operations quickly.

**3. Customization Options**.

Vertical FRP tanks come with a high degree of customization. Industries can specify dimensions, shapes, and lining materials based on their unique requirements. This flexibility ensures that companies can find a tailored solution to fit their specific processes, whether they are storing wastewater, chemicals, or other liquids. Customization can also enhance efficiency by optimizing the tank design for the intended use.

**4. Durable and Long-lasting**.

Durability is another significant advantage of FRP tanks. They are resilient against various physical and environmental factors, including temperature fluctuations, UV exposure, and impact. This durability means that companies can rely on their tanks for long-term use without the frequent need for repairs or replacements, ultimately leading to lower operational costs.

**5. Cost-Effectiveness**.

While the initial cost of FRP tanks might be slightly higher than traditional options, the long-term savings make them a more economically viable choice. The reduced maintenance costs, lower energy consumption during operation, and extended service life contribute to a better return on investment. Moreover, their lightweight structure allows for easier installation, further minimizing labor costs.

**6. FDA Compliance for Food Applications**.

In industries dealing with food and beverages, compliance with health and safety regulations is paramount. FRP tanks can be designed to meet FDA standards, making them suitable for storing food-grade liquids. This compliance ensures that the products remain uncontaminated and safe for consumer consumption, allowing businesses to operate confidently under regulatory guidelines.

**7. Applications Across Various Industries**.

Vertical FRP tanks find applications across a wide range of industries, including chemical processing, wastewater treatment, agriculture, and food and beverage. In the chemical industry, they are used for storage and mixing of hazardous materials. In wastewater treatment, their corrosion resistance makes them ideal for holding corrosive and toxic fluids. In agriculture, these tanks can store fertilizers and other chemicals safely. The versatility of FRP tanks allows them to meet diverse industrial needs effectively.

**8. Environmental Considerations**.

As industries become more environmentally conscious, the shift towards sustainable practices is more important than ever. FRP tanks can be designed to be more energy efficient and have the potential to be recycled or repurposed at the end of their life cycle. This sustainability aspect adds another layer of appeal for modern businesses aiming to reduce their ecological footprint.

**Conclusion**.

Vertical FRP tanks are becoming an indispensable asset in various industrial applications due to their numerous benefits, ranging from corrosion resistance and customization to cost-effectiveness and durability. As industries continue to evolve, understanding and harnessing the advantages of FRP technology will be crucial for staying ahead in a competitive market. By investing in vertical FRP tanks, businesses can enhance operational efficiency, comply with regulatory standards, and promote sustainability—all while safeguarding their bottom line.
